South Korean Veteran Loses Arm Fighting North Koreans in Ukraine

Lee Byung-hun, a former South Korean soldier, lost his arm fighting in Ukraine alongside Ukrainian forces against North Korean troops; approximately one-third of the 11,000 North Korean soldiers deployed have been killed or wounded due to ill-preparedness and direct-charge tactics.

Tripartite Meeting Condemns North Korea, Addresses Indo-Pacific Concerns

South Korean, Japanese, and U.S. foreign ministers met in Munich on February 15, 2025, to reaffirm their commitment to North Korea's denuclearization, condemn its human rights abuses, and express concerns about its military cooperation with Russia and its impact on the Indo-Pacific region.

North Korean Defector to Debut in US K-Pop Band

Yu Hyuk, a 25-year-old North Korean defector who once begged on the streets, will debut in the US this year as a member of the K-pop boy band 1Verse, marking a historical first for the genre.

North Korea Treats Hundreds of Wounded Russian Soldiers, Deepening Military Ties

Hundreds of wounded Russian soldiers are receiving free medical treatment in North Korea, further strengthening the military and political ties between the two nations, which have deepened since a June defense pact. North Korea Condemns US Submarine Docking in South Korea

North Korea condemned the docking of the USS Alexandria, a US nuclear submarine, in South Korea on Monday as a "hostile military act," escalating tensions on the Korean peninsula.
